Параметры сортировки и типы данных интеграции со средой CLR
Применимо к:SQL Server
В платформа .NET Framework объект CompareInfo обрабатывает параметры сортировки. Платформа .NET Framework строковые интерфейсы api для сравнения строк используют свойство CompareInfo, связанное с объектом CultureInfo текущего потока. Значение по умолчанию объекта CultureInfo основано на параметре языкового стандарта Microsoft Windows для компьютера, на котором работает Microsoft SQL Server. Она определяет семантику сравнения по умолчанию для сравнения значений типа CultureInfo , если свойство System.String не задано явно. SQL Server явно не изменяет свойство CompareInfo на параметры сортировки базы данных или сервера. При необходимости пользователи должны самостоятельно устанавливать свойство CompareInfo в своих программах.
Параметр с параметрами сортировки
При создании подпрограммы СРЕДЫ CLR, а параметр метода CLR, привязанного к подпрограмме, имеет тип SQLString, SQL Server создает экземпляр параметра с параметрами сортировки по умолчанию для базы данных, содержащей вызывающую подпрограмму. Если параметр имеет тип, отличный от SqlType (например, String , а не SQLString), сведения о параметрах сортировки из базы данных с этим параметром не связываются.
См. также:
Обратная связь
https://aka.ms/ContentUserFeedback.
Ожидается в ближайшее время: в течение 2024 года мы постепенно откажемся от GitHub Issues как механизма обратной связи для контента и заменим его новой системой обратной связи. Дополнительные сведения см. в разделеОтправить и просмотреть отзыв по